    This location is SUPER lowkey and I see why they are. The menu here is HUGE, but so simple. Very affordable and the staff is super family orientated which we love. It is very small inside, but they also have an outside seating and to be honest either or is super accommodating. We were a party of 5 and everything we ate did not disappoint. I had the biscuit and gravy with bacon, eggs and a waffle on the side. I personally had to season my gravy, but I like that a lot only because I like how to season my own sausage and gravy. After I seasoned it, I demolished every bite of it. I also tried my husbands chicken fried steak and of course you can't mess that up. They also have two options of hash brown and both versions (country and shredded potatoes) are cooked perfectly unless you asked them super well done. The waffle its self was super fluffy and perfectly sweet with syrup drenched in it. We definitely make this our weekend spot as a treat only because they are closed by 7pm. Haven't gone here during dinner, but hopefully we can make it. Other than that, we've been here 3x's already and we stick to the breakfast only because we want to try everything - LOL! Next on our list is their Texas frenchtoast. I will say with this place growing with customers, be PATIENT with the staff because they're sweet and spot on with orders.
